When comparing Bitcoin mining devices, understanding their efficiency in crypto investment during market volatility is key. Each hardware has its own power consumption rates and hashing speeds, which directly impact profitability. During bull markets when Bitcoin prices surge, high-efficiency miners can capitalize on the increased value by processing more blocks and earning higher rewards. Conversely, in bear markets where prices drop, the same devices might incur more energy costs than they generate in returns.

Costs are another critical factor to consider. High-performance ASICs, for instance, offer superior mining capabilities but come at a premium price. Lower-cost GPUs or FPGAs may be more accessible for budget-conscious miners, but their efficiency and performance during market volatility can vary significantly.
